Primary inflammation in human cystic fibrosis small airways -- Lung

Cellular and Molecular Physiology

http://www.pulmonologylinx.com/thearts.cfm?artid=381170&specid=14>

http://www.pulmonologylinx.com/thearts.cfm?artid=381170&specid=14

Conclusion: This model of mature human small airways provides the first

clear-cut evidence that, in CF, inflammation may arise at least partly

from a primary defect in the regulation of neutrophil recruitment,

independently of infection...
